Frequently Asked Questions about Boston

How much are Studio apartments in Boston?

There are currently 3,785 Studio Apartments in Boston with rent ranges from $1,200 to $9,755 with an average price of $2,663.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Boston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Boston ranges from $825 to $13,489 with an average monthly rent of $3,060.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Boston c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Boston range from $900 to $27,790.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,751.

How expensive are Boston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 2,956 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Boston on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$900 to $20,550 - averaging $4,086 for the location.
